Overview

If you don't have long in Zanzibar, this full-day tour makes the most of your time—and leaves the navigation and logistics to someone else. Following hotel pickup, embark on a snorkeling excursion to Mnemba Island, known for clear waters filled with marine life. Next, visit Kuza Caves to swim and learn about Swahili history and music. Enjoy lunch at a local restaurant, and then visit Salam Cave Aquarium.

Pickup on time, but no explanations about the procedure and also otherwise no explanations about the country and people during the many time in the car. Instead, silence in the car. The first snorkeling spot was not, as the headline and the pictures of the tour suggest, on Mnemba Island, but far in the sea next to the island. The island is privately owned and may not be approached. Before that there was a real hunt for dolphins. Constantly pursued and circled by motorboats and followed by snorkelers in the water, this part of the excursion was more of a shock than an experience. Especially when knowing how the whole thing is respectfully done on the Azores. In wet clothes we went on, because at Mnemba Beach there is no changing room. So with bathing suits and bathing shoes off to Kuza cave. There again was same water so the wet clothes were not in vain. But also here hardly explanations about the location, but letting the. guests have a swim and off we go. Next stop was Starfish Beach. But it was not a beach but a 0.7m deep place in the sea where the animals are. So with snorkel and goggles, or not at all. After that we came to the famous restaurant The Rock at the nearby beach. We were 30 minutes early and thought we could still change clothes at the nearby parked car, but no go. With wet swimming trunks and water shoes we were allowed into the restaurant and felt quite miserable. Beautiful location but for memory photos not the right outfit. About the restaurant it should be said that as vegetarians we took the one menu available and can not say anything about the fish dishes. But for a portion of rice and three pieces of traditional bread and a small portion of very mild vegetable curry $ 23 is a rip-off. So if you know about the country and the people beforehand and only want to visit the places mentioned and if you don't mind sitting in a bathing suit in a restaurant, this tour is recommended. To all others we advise perhaps to make a similar tour, but not this one.
